The Cameron Foundation is seeking a Database and Technology Assistant to support the work of the Grants Manager in administering the Foundation’s grantmaking processes, including database management, grants applications, and reporting processes. They will also provide assistance with using Constant Contact to generate communication emails and update email lists that optimize email campaigns, promote foundation events, and support other marketing tasks.

The Database and Technology Assistant will also provide Audio Visual (AV) technology support for Cameron’s meeting spaces and special events, as well as handle other related administrative supports as needed.

Location: Petersburg, VA (onsite position)
Hours:
Approximately 15-20 hours per week
Reports to: Grants Manager
Compensation: $21 to $25 per hour

Key Responsibilities

Grants Administration & Support:

  • Assist the Grants Manager with the day-to-day functions of Foundant Grant Lifecycle Management (GLM), Cameron’s grants management system.
  • Provide assistance to staff in accessing and utilizing database information, addressing queries and/or issues that may arise.
  • Support data entry, maintenance, and quality assurance tasks.
  • Help track grant application statuses, reporting deadlines, and payments.
  • Support the preparation of grant application materials, award notifications, and reports for internal review.
  • Respond to basic applicant and grantee inquiries regarding the grants system and process.
  • Support the maintenance of accurate grantee records and documentation in the database.

Constant Contact Support:

  • Provide support by creating and executing email campaigns using the Constant Contact platform.
  • Segment email lists to ensure targeted and personalized messaging.
  • Monitor and generate reports on email campaign performance (including open rates, click-through rates, and conversion rates).
  • Maintain and update email lists, ensuring accurate and clean data for campaign targeting.

Technology & AV Support:

  • Serve as the primary point person for AV support in the Foundation’s three meeting rooms (each room is Zoom-enabled for hybrid meeting capability) and for occasional offsite events.
  • Assist staff and visitors with Zoom functionality, troubleshooting, and AV setup during meetings.

Administrative Support:

  • Provide occasional administrative support for Board members and program officers.
  • Provide occasional backup coverage for administrative staff, including answering phones and assisting with general community inquiries.
  • Assist with special projects and research, as assigned.

Qualifications & Skills

  • Proficiency with databases and grants management systems (experience with Foundant GLM preferred).
  • Proficiency using Constant Contract for email marketing.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, Outlook, PowerPoint).
  • Knowledge of HTML and CSS for email customization.
  • Experience with A/B testing, data analysis, and reporting.
  • Understanding of email marketing best practices and strategies.
  • Technical aptitude with willingness to learn and support AV systems.
  • Ability to multi-task, work independently and collaborate as part of a team.
  • Detail and deadline oriented, with a focus on work product accuracy and quality.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.

Preferred Experience:

  • Prior experience in grants administration, nonprofit work, or a related field is a plus.
  • Familiarity with philanthropy or foundation operations.

Education: At minimum, an associates degree or certification in information systems, computer science or related field is required.

About the Cameron Foundation

The Cameron Foundation strives to transform the Tri-Cities and surrounding counties into a healthy, vibrant and economically vital region by strategically leveraging resources for community impact. Founded in 2003, The Cameron Foundation is a private foundation that was formed from the proceeds of the sale of Southside Regional Medical Center by the Hospital Authority of the City of Petersburg. The Foundation’s service area spans the cities of Petersburg, Colonial Heights and Hopewell; the counties of Dinwiddie, Prince George and Sussex; and, southern Chesterfield County. Since the Foundation began grantmaking in 2004, it has awarded more than $113 million to organizations serving residents of this area.
